Day 11: Share a piece of art, old or new...
that Still Means Something to YOU. What once lit us up might have served its purpose, a capture of a moment in time, a version of us that needed that moment. And that’s okay. Growth means allowing what’s meaningful to evolve. take a quiet moment to notice what still feels alive in your heart… and what might be ready to be released with love. 🕯️ Reflection prompt: “What in my life once mattered deeply but no longer feels aligned — and what new meaning wants to take its place?” For me it is: 1. 🖤 Black & White Heart: This piece was created during a time of deep darkness and confusion. Back then, much of my art lived only in shades of black and white, a reflection of how life felt. 2. 🪷 My first mural — painted for Homes of Harmony in a small village near Jilin, China. The space was run by a kind-hearted French couple who opened their home as a non-profit sanctuary. Creating their meditation room felt like painting peace into the walls. 3. 🎨 Collage with My Students: During my time living in China, I often felt disjointed and out of place. Art became my anchor. This collage was one of many pieces I made alongside my high school students while teaching art for six months — a reminder that creativity can always connect us, no matter where we are in the world.
